School committee pledges continuing support for Everett High gender-and-sexuality alliance flag-raising
Summary
The Everett School Committee voted Oct. 6 to continue official support for Everett High School's gender-and-sexuality alliance (GSA) flag-raising next June; students and staff described the event as significant for LGBTQIA+ inclusion.
The Everett School Committee voted on Oct. 6 to continue institutional support for an annual flag-raising organized by Everett High School's gender-and-sexuality alliance. The item, offered by School Committee member Almeida Barros, asked the committee to "continue to support the [flag] raising on 06/01/2026" and to thank GSA educators for organizing the event.
